Transaction 08f832c93391bce80a6157d637013fe96335b2e6313af7c97496c3dfd6c92b74
1 Input
2 Outputs
- 08f832c93391bce80a6157d637013fe96335b2e6313af7c97496c3dfd6c92b74:0
- 08f832c93391bce80a6157d637013fe96335b2e6313af7c97496c3dfd6c92b74:1
value 135362211
address 1LE1VUmgAnRdnAzexxmg2ofrgZTY7iaKUR
value 61071089
address 1CVr67J4HYywXeughtgGTXgEHW4KFCHUgU